Applying a visual attention mechanism to the problem of traffic sign recognition 视觉注意机制在交通标志识别中的应用
Proceedings. XV Brazilian Symposium on Computer Graphics and Image Processing Pub Date : 2002-10-07 DOI: 10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167187
Fabrício Augusto Rodrigues, H. Gomes
{"title":"Applying a visual attention mechanism to the problem of traffic sign recognition","authors":"Fabrício Augusto Rodrigues, H. Gomes","doi":"10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167187","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167187","url":null,"abstract":"Driving a vehicle is a highly intensive visual information processing task in which traffic sign recognition plays an important role. Reports have shown that a great deal of the crashes at intersections and head-on collisions could be avoided if the driver had an additional half-second to react, and that inattentive drivers are the cause of most crashes. Therefore, this is an interesting field for the investigation of computer vision techniques. Within this context we are concerned with the automatic detection and classification of traffic signs in images acquired from a moving car. In order to reduce the amount of information to process, we employed a bottom-up visual attention mechanism to locate only the most promising points within each frame. Given a set of interest points, another module tries to match previously learnt traffic sign models against image regions centred on these points via a neural network approach. This paper focuses on the design aspects and preliminary results of the attention mechanism.","PeriodicalId":286814,"journal":{"name":"Proceedings. Evaluating an adaptive windowing scheme in speckle noise MAP filtering 散斑噪声MAP滤波中自适应开窗方案的评价
Proceedings. XV Brazilian Symposium on Computer Graphics and Image Processing Pub Date : 2002-10-07 DOI: 10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167126
F. Medeiros, N. Mascarenhas, R. Marques, Cassius M. Laprano
{"title":"Evaluating an adaptive windowing scheme in speckle noise MAP filtering","authors":"F. Medeiros, N. Mascarenhas, R. Marques, Cassius M. Laprano","doi":"10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167126","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167126","url":null,"abstract":"Synthetic aperture radar (SAR) images are corrupted by speckle noise, which degrades the quality and interpretation of the images. Speckle removal provides a better interpretability of SAR images if the technique performs the filtering without loss of spatial resolution and preserves fine details and edges. This work aims to redefine the neighborhood areas around the noisy pixel and in this area the local mean and variance are computed to estimate the Maximum a Posteriori (MAP) filter parameters. The proposed modified MAP algorithm improves the ability to filter the speckle noise without blurring edges and targets by applying the MAP estimator in the current adaptive window that is controlled by a measure of homogeneity in the area around the noisy pixel. This adaptive windowing was also incorporated to the classical Kuan et al. (1985) and Frost et al. (1982) filters in order to evaluate the performance of the proposed scheme. The effectiveness in reducing speckle by the modified MAP filter is evaluated in terms of qualitative and quantitative aspects such as line and edge preservation and the improvement of the signal to noise ratio. The tests were performed in real SAR images.","PeriodicalId":286814,"journal":{"name":"Proceedings. How to support collaborative modelling with the emerging standard MPEG-4 MU 如何支持新兴标准MPEG-4 MU的协作建模
Proceedings. XV Brazilian Symposium on Computer Graphics and Image Processing Pub Date : 2002-10-07 DOI: 10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167206
F. V. Duarte, M. Verdi, R. B. Araujo
{"title":"How to support collaborative modelling with the emerging standard MPEG-4 MU","authors":"F. V. Duarte, M. Verdi, R. B. Araujo","doi":"10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167206","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/SIBGRA.2002.1167206","url":null,"abstract":"In a collaborative modelling environment, multiple users may interact in a virtual environment to deform or modify shared 3D objects (e.g., for modelling and visualization of virtual prototypes). The challenges to collaborative modelling are related mainly to four aspects: user interaction with the virtual modelling environment, 3D object concurrent editing, consistency maintenance among client terminals and real time rendering of the modified 3D objects. The use of Non-Uniform Rational B-Splines (NURBS) surfaces accelerates the rendering process since a small number of control points are used to represent the objects, resulting in a large data compression. Nowadays a number of technologies has either emerged or evolved to support 3D environments, such as: X3D, Java3D and MPEG-4 MU. This paper shows how the emerging MPEG-4 MU standard can be used to support real-time modelling through NURBS in a shared virtual environment among multiple client terminals.","PeriodicalId":286814,"journal":{"name":"Proceedings.
